This issue first came up during the Clinton administration.

At the time, World Net Daily was leading the charge for alternative news outlets. Congress (or their "organization of journalists" as you refer to) decided that WND was not an accredited news organization and refused to give them press passes to the Congress galleries. Up to that point, WND was getting daily passes, but they wanted the same accredited passes that the NYT, WaPo, NBC, ABC, CBS, Time, Newsweek, et. al., were getting.

WND was being singled out at the time because of the reporting of Paul Sperry. Sperry reported on several hot issues for Clinton: 1) Lewinsky, 2) Sperry embarrassed Clinton during a White House Easter Egg event for the families of WH staffers, 3) the missing Gore emails and missing backups, 4) the intentionally downgraded phone systems in the WH that can't show which specific telephone placed a specific call.

WND was refused permanent accreditation, and a fight ensued. WND eventually won a permanent press pass. They probably didn't realize it at the time, but they were legitimizing the alternative media for everyone else to come.
